I just wanted to chime in that I've played about 3 hours of Platinum on TWiLightMenu v11.0.0, and nds-bootstrap v0.27.0, and I haven't experienced any such freezes.ĭoesn't really seem to make a difference, but decided to specify this just in case. I haven't reached Eterna City yet, so I can't test the Underground at the moment, but normal gameplay has seemed entirely normal. I'm not sure which of these settings causes the instability, but it seems Platinum really doesn't like being played with any "enhancements." However, the game will freeze quite frequently if I run the game in DSi Mode with TWL clock speeds and VRAM boost enabled. When running with the settings mentioned above, I once had the game completely black out on the title screen. ![]() I pressed 'A' after the GameFreak logo to skip the intro sequence, and both screens cut to black. But the full audio for the intro sequence still played, and it would just hang after the intro music stopped at the point the title screen would show.Īnother crash happened after I was able to successfully load a save. As soon as my character was visible, the music would still play, but the game was completely frozen. Even background objects that had animations stood still. I could not control the character and had to reset the console.Īgain, just leaving TWiLightMenu's nds-bootstrap settings alone, and running it at DS clock speeds with no VRAM boost, seems to work best for me. It's strange that the game is so unstable in TWL mode, considering the compatibility list has TWL listed as the "recommended" speed, but this has been my experience so far.
